Position Overview
We are looking for a skilled OPP scheduler practitioner to assist with schedule enhancement deployment across the business. The successful candidate will join the RAAF Wedgetail Development Program Integrated Planning & Scheduling Team.
The role can be performed from Brisbane or Williamtown offices. You will be working closely with the Program Scheduling Lead, and emersed in Boeing Best Schedule Practices with a strategic focus on Programmatic planning that will enable you to support the needs of many different executing projects and proposals for new projects.
Key Responsibilities:
  • Support executing projects scheduling and status needs
  • Assist / lead programmatic development and maintenance of strategic planning artifacts to support execution.
  • Assist, lead & develop IP&S schedule execution reporting improvements and analysis to identify trends and areas for improvement.
  • Provide surge campaign support to meet project demands, including leading complex schedule development efforts that align with program execution plans

Qualifications:
  • Prior experience with OPP in the Defence Industry, COBRA usage is an advantage
  • 5+ years of experience in scheduling or program planning with 3+ years within the defence industry, or a relevant degree with 3+ years within the defence industry
  • Extensive experience in operating Project Scheduling & Earned Value in a commercial environment
  • Strong knowledge of project planning principles and techniques to achieve desired project outcome, including resource management
  • Strong Knowledge of planning & scheduling theory, concepts and principles required to deliver project outcomes
  • Excellent analytical and problem-solving skills.
  • Develop collaborative relationships in a team-based environment and builds rapport and trust among stakeholders
  • Applicants must be an Australian Citizen and hold, or have ability to obtain, an Australian defence security clearance.

What you need to know about the Melbourne Tech Scene

Home to 650 biotech companies, 10 major research institutes and nine universities, Melbourne is among one of the top cities for biotech. In fact, some of the greatest medical advancements were conceptualized and developed here, including Symex Lab's "lab-on-a-chip" solution that monitors hormones to predict ovulation for conception, and Denteric's vaccine for periodontal gum disease. Yet, the thousands of people working in the city's healthtech sector are just getting started, to say nothing of the tech advancements across all other sectors.
